This Day in Auto History: 6.29.1911 Ettore Bugatti is issued a German patent for the “pursang” trademark 6.29.1927 The 1928 Nashes are introduced 6.29.1938 G. D. Boerlage of the Royal Dutch/Shell Group dies at age 52 6.29.1948 A. K. Brumbaugh, a design engineer with Autocar and White, dies in Palo Alto, CA at age 64 6.29.1979 Chevrolet collector Bob Van Etten dies
